file-type

ASP.NET图书网站源代码与数据库结构解析

RAR文件

3星 · 超过75%的资源 | 下载需积分: 50 | 9.46MB | 更新于2025-03-12 | 85 浏览量 | 14 下载量 举报 收藏
download 立即下载
根据给定的文件信息,我们可以提取出以下IT相关知识点: 1. **ASP.NET网站开发基础**: - ASP.NET是一种建立在.NET框架上的用于构建Web应用程序的平台。它是一个服务器端的Web应用框架,用于创建动态网页、网站和Web应用程序。 - ASP.NET网页通常是由服务器端的C#或VB.NET代码构成,这些代码可以执行服务器上的逻辑处理,并在客户端浏览器中生成HTML。 - ASP.NET提供了多种技术,包括MVC(Model-View-Controller),Web Forms,Web Pages和SignalR等,用于构建可伸缩、安全的Web应用程序。 2. **ASP.NET MVC架构**: - 描述中的代码片段明显显示了ASP.NET MVC架构的使用。在MVC中,“Model”表示数据模型,“View”表示用户界面,“Controller”则负责处理用户请求,并调用相应的模型和视图。 - Html.Encode()是一个在ASP.NET MVC中常用的帮助方法,用于对输出内容进行HTML编码,防止跨站脚本攻击(XSS)。 3. **数据绑定和动态内容生成**: - 强调的代码展示了如何在ASP.NET页面中动态绑定数据。book对象的数据被绑定到视图中相应的位置,这些数据通常来自后端数据库。 - <%= ... %> 是ASP.NET页面中使用的一种服务器端脚本标记,用于输出服务器端变量的值到HTML页面中。 4. **ASP.NET数据库操作**: - 网站源代码中提到了数据库,这暗示了网站是基于数据库驱动的,用于存储书籍信息,如标题、作者、出版日期和内容等。 - ASP.NET可以使用ADO.NET或Entity Framework等技术来实现数据库的交互操作,包括数据的增删改查等功能。 5. **HTML编码和安全**: - 对输出到页面的内容使用Html.Encode()进行HTML编码是防止跨站脚本攻击(XSS)的重要措施。XSS攻击能够让攻击者将恶意脚本注入到其他用户浏览的页面中,因此在Web开发中是必须考虑的安全因素。 6. **标签和文件命名规范**: - 标签中包含的"asp.net asp 源代码 网站 数据库",这些标签反映了该文件的主要技术和用途。 - 文件名称“图书网站最终版”暗示了这是一个特定的应用程序版本,通常在软件开发生命周期中表示已经通过所有测试并且准备发布给用户的版本。 7. **Web应用的构建和部署**: - 要创建一个基于ASP.NET的网站,开发人员需要理解如何在Visual Studio这样的IDE中构建项目,并且知道如何部署网站到Web服务器(如IIS)。 - 构建ASP.NET网站涉及到编写代码、设计数据库、设置网站布局、配置服务器以及执行测试等多个步骤。 综合以上知识点,可以看出给定文件描述了一个典型的ASP.NET网站项目,其中涉及到的技术包括ASP.NET MVC框架、数据绑定、数据库操作、HTML编码、安全性、Web应用的构建和部署等。这些知识点对于理解和开发ASP.NET网站至关重要。

相关推荐

dearpeer
  • 粉丝: 38
上传资源 快速赚钱